I am a Ghanaian travelling to New Zealand via Hong Kong will I need a transit Visa

I am a Ghanaian travelling to New Zealnd via Hong Kong will I need a transit Visa. If so where can I apply and how long will it take. I live in Ghana

You need to apply for a HK visa in advance unless you hold Ghana Diplomatic and Official passports. So, just submit your application to Chinese embassy. The processing takes about one month because all applications will be sent to HK immigration for approval.
